Warner Bros. Gets Hostile Bid from Paramount, Tesla Falls, Strategy Rises


Listen Later

On this episode of Stock Movers:

- Warner Bros. Discovery (WBD) received a hostile takeover bid from Paramount Skydance for $30 a share in cash on Monday, just days after the company agreed to a deal with Netflix Inc. The offer values Warner Bros. at $108.4 billion, including debt. The bid compares with Netflix’s offer of $27.75 in cash and stock. Paramount’s offer is for all of Warner Bros., while Netflix is interested only in the Hollywood studios, HBO and the streaming business. Warner Bros. shares were up 3.1% to $26.90 at 1:35 p.m. in New York on Monday. Paramount was up 8% while Netflix was down 4.3%.

- Elon Musk is eager to transform Tesla (TSLA) into a robotics and artificial intelligence company, but the electric-vehicle maker’s stock price already reflects those businesses and is at a “full valuation,” according to Morgan Stanley, which lowered its rating on the company to the equivalent of a hold, its first cut since June 2023. Tesla shares trade at about 210 times projected earnings over the next 12 months, making it the second most expensive company in S&P 500 Index, trailing just Warner Brothers Discovery Inc. at 220 times and well ahead of third place Palantir Technologies Inc.’s multiple of 186. The stock fell as much as 3% on Monday to trade around $441. 

- Strategy (MSTR) shares rose in trading Monday after the digital asset treasury company said it bought $962.7 million worth of Bitcoin from Dec. 1 to Dec. 7, marking its largest acquisition since July. Strategy’s Bitcoin holdings are now worth more than $60 billion, but the company’s premium to its token holdings has continued to shrink. Strategy’s enterprise value at one point worth more than 2.5 times its Bitcoin holdings, but that has now fallen to a multiple of 1.1.
